Miklós Horthy
Born: June 18, 1868
Died: February 9, 1957 (aged 88)
Bio: Miklós Horthy de Nagybánya was a Hungarian admiral and statesman, who served as Regent of the Kingdom of Hungary between World Wars I and II and throughout most of World War II, from 1 March 1920 to 15 October 1944.
